Regulatory Compliance

Hospitals face a significant challenge in terms of regulatory compliance when it comes to digital marketing. Strict regulations like GDPR and HIPAA impose stringent requirements on how patient data is collected, stored, and used in online marketing efforts. Hospitals must diligently navigate these complex regulations to safeguard patient privacy and maintain compliance, adding an extra layer of complexity to their digital marketing initiatives. Failure to adhere to these regulations can result in severe penalties and damage to the hospital’s reputation, making regulatory compliance a critical con that hospitals must carefully manage in their digital marketing strategies.

What are the 4 types of SEO?

When it comes to Search Engine Optimization (SEO), understanding the different types is essential for implementing an effective strategy. The four main types of SEO include on-page SEO, off-page SEO, technical SEO, and local SEO. On-page SEO focuses on optimizing individual web pages with relevant content and keywords. Off-page SEO involves building quality backlinks from external websites to improve a site’s authority and credibility. Technical SEO deals with the technical aspects of a website, such as site speed and mobile-friendliness. Local SEO targets local search results to help businesses attract nearby customers. By incorporating these various types of SEO into a comprehensive marketing plan, businesses can enhance their online visibility and reach their target audience more effectively.

What are the 3 types of SEO?

When it comes to Search Engine Optimization (SEO), there are three main types that businesses and website owners should be aware of. The first type is On-Page SEO, which involves optimizing individual web pages with relevant content, meta tags, and keywords to improve their search engine rankings. The second type is Off-Page SEO, which focuses on building backlinks from reputable websites to increase a site’s authority and credibility in the eyes of search engines. Lastly, Technical SEO involves optimizing the technical aspects of a website, such as site speed, mobile-friendliness, and structured data markup, to enhance its performance in search results. Understanding and implementing these three types of SEO can help businesses improve their online visibility and attract more organic traffic to their websites.

What tools can help with content creation?

When it comes to content creation, there are various tools available to assist in the process and enhance the quality of your output. From content planning and idea generation to design and editing, tools such as content management systems like WordPress, graphic design software like Canva or Adobe Creative Cloud, keyword research tools like SEMrush or Ahrefs, and grammar checking tools like Grammarly can all play a valuable role in streamlining your content creation workflow. These tools can help you create engaging and visually appealing content that resonates with your audience while saving time and improving overall efficiency.

What is retargeting in online advertising?

Retargeting in online advertising is a powerful strategy that involves targeting users who have previously interacted with a brand’s website or products. This technique allows businesses to display tailored ads to these users as they browse the internet, reminding them of their interest and encouraging them to revisit the site or complete a desired action. By keeping their brand top of mind and re-engaging with potential customers, retargeting helps businesses increase conversion rates and drive meaningful engagement with their target audience.
